Data notes

NGOs are only included if they say they work in fewer than 50 countries. This is because some organisations claim they are working in every single country in the world, or very large numbers of countries. This is unlikely. So we can exclude them by restricting the number of countries organisations work in.

The figures for income and spending include the total income and spending of the organisations in all the countries they work in.

Religious organisations refers to those organisations which self-describe themselves as undertaking "religious activities" in their causes.

The Hill 112 Memorial Foundation

Charity number 1181345

21/12/2018

Latest income £48,056

[Apr 2025]

We are a charity which are raising funds to make a film on the horrendous battle for Hill 112 during the Normandy Campaign. It is also to further the legacy that Mr Albert Figg left with all his work on Hill 112 with the following memorials that he raised funds for:- A Churchill Tank, A 25 Pounder Field Gun, A Statue of an Infantryman and 112 trees shaped in the cross.
